Pokemon FireRed and LeafGreen - Freeze Status Effect and How to Cure

This is a guide for the Freeze status effect in Pokemon FireRed and LeafGreen (FRLG). See details about the effects of Freeze, a list of all moves that inflict Freeze, and how to cure Freeze here!

All Freeze Effects

Freeze Effects

List of Freeze Effects
In Battle: A Frozen Pokemon is unable to move (except for moves that thaw).
In Battle: A Frozen Pokemon has a 20% chance of being thawed out in each turn.

How to Cure Freeze

Guide for Curing Freeze





Use Items That Can Cure Freeze

Item Type Description
Ice Heal Recovery A spray-type medicine. It defrosts a frozen Pokémon.
Aspear Berry Berry A Berry to be consumed by Pokémon. If a Pokémon holds one, it can recover from being frozen on its own in battle.
